Q1: What is Alabama's standard tax rate for 2025?
A: The standard rate is currently 5%, but check for updates as the legislature may change rates.
Q2: What deductions are available in Alabama?
A: Common deductions include federal tax paid, retirement contributions, and certain itemized deductions.

Q4: Does this include local taxes?
A: No, this calculator only estimates state income tax. Some Alabama localities have additional taxes.
